The Morning After

A Poem by Roderick Blakeman
"

One drink too many

"
I woke up feeling dreadful 
after a night out on the town
and did my best to smile 
but could only frown

The lady laying next to me 
said "who the hell are you"
which shows how rough I looked that morn
as it was my love so true

She berated me with words so harsh
for getting in that state
asking when I'd got home 
she knew it must be late

But for all the questions put to me
for answers I had none
no idea where I'd been
or of what I'd done

Picking up the phone and dialling
my wife did ring my pal 
The Spanish Inquisition 
they had nothing on this gal

He got asked a thousand questions
at the speed of light
and as luck would have it
he got them mostly right

As the conversation finished
and she put down the phone
my darling wife looked at me
and said in a sweet tone

Apparently you behaved yourself 
even while off your head
telling all and sundry 
of the lovely girl you'd wed

About how much you were missing me 
while being out alone
and what you were going to do to me 
when you got back home

You told them all you loved me 
and that you'd married well
in fact anyone that listened 
you did gladly tell

So with a smile she kissed me
while whispering in my ear
she said "I love you too my darling" 
as she shed a tear

And that is why I'm happy 
and content as I can be
'cause the girl I love and treasure 
is also loving me
